Cerro de las Papas
Cerro de las Papas is a locality in Mezquital Municipality, Durango and has about 184 residents and an elevation of 2,622 metres. Cerro de las Papas is situated nearby to the locality La Cascada, as well as near La Ciénega.| Tap on a place to explore it |
